Descripció:In Costa Rica, although water resources are abundant, certain areas face difficulties due to reduced availability for residents, leading to issues in supplying water for domestic and industrial use. The School of Geographic Sciences has actively addressed this issue. Since 2001, it has been quantifying water resources through the calculation of water balances in the micro-watersheds of the Poás, Ciruelas, Segundo, Bermúdez, Tibás, and Pará rivers. These studies have determined that the predominant availability is moderate, which suggests that it will soon become low. Therefore, it is urgent to implement proper management of the micro-watersheds to mitigate excessive water use.
